What to check before for pre-war buildings near the 4 train in NYC

  • Compare buildings by the pre-war filter (built before 1947) and their location near the 4 train route.
  • Before signing, verify the full monthly cost (rent plus deposit, broker fee if applicable, and utilities) since asking rent alone can be misleading.
  • Confirm building policies that affect move-in logistics: leasing procedures, package handling, elevator access, and any move-in fees.
  • Ask about lease structure and renewal terms, especially if a building’s unit availability or regulation status varies by apartment.
  • If you see gaps in open-data signals, rely on the building directly for the latest maintenance, pest-control, and inspection status.
